My Buying Guides on Solar Powered Ceiling Fan For Gazebo
When I started looking for a solar powered ceiling fan for my gazebo, I quickly realized that not all models are built the same. Some are great for small shaded spaces, while others are better for larger outdoor areas that need stronger airflow. To help you make a smart choice, I put together the main things I would personally check before buying one.
1. Check the Fan Size and Gazebo Dimensions
The first thing I look at is the size of my gazebo. A fan that is too small will not move enough air, while one that is too large may feel overpowering in a compact space. I always compare the fan blade span with the gazebo’s width so I can match the airflow to the area.
2. Look at Solar Panel Quality
Since the fan depends on solar power, I pay close attention to the solar panel. I prefer a panel with good efficiency, durable construction, and enough wattage to run the fan properly. If the panel is weak, the fan may not perform well during cloudy weather or late in the day.
3. Consider Battery Backup
For me, a battery backup is a major plus. It lets the fan keep running even when the sun is not shining brightly. I find this especially useful during evenings or on overcast days. If I want more reliable comfort, I always choose a model with a solid battery system.
4. Review Airflow Performance
I never buy a fan without checking its airflow rating. The amount of air it moves makes a big difference in how comfortable my gazebo feels. I usually look for a fan with adjustable speeds so I can control the breeze based on the weather.
5. Choose Weather-Resistant Materials
Because my gazebo is outdoors, I need a fan that can handle sun, humidity, and occasional moisture. I look for rust-resistant metal, UV-protected parts, and blades made for outdoor use. This helps me avoid frequent repairs and replacement.
6. Check Installation Requirements
I always want a fan that is easy to install. Some solar powered ceiling fans come with simple mounting systems, while others may need professional help. Before I buy, I make sure the fan can be mounted securely in my gazebo structure and that the solar panel placement is practical.
7. Look for Remote or Speed Controls
I personally like having easy control over the fan. A remote control, wall switch, or multiple speed settings makes the fan much more convenient to use. It is especially helpful when I am relaxing in the gazebo and do not want to get up to adjust it.
8. Think About Noise Level
A quiet fan is important to me because I use my gazebo for relaxing, reading, or spending time with family. I always check whether the fan is designed for low-noise operation. A noisy fan can take away from the peaceful outdoor atmosphere.
9. Compare Price and Long-Term Value
I do not just look at the upfront price. I think about how much value the fan gives me over time. A slightly more expensive fan may be worth it if it has better durability, stronger airflow, and a dependable solar system. For me, long-term performance matters more than saving a little money at first.
10. Read Customer Reviews
Before I make my final choice, I always read reviews from other buyers. Their experiences help me understand how the fan performs in real outdoor settings. I pay attention to comments about battery life, airflow, durability, and ease of installation.
